WHAT - 6 weeks till the International tri - sigh. I'm a bit surprised at myself the past couple of weeks, thought that I had done better than what is listed above. So what has happened? I will not dwell I will focus on the future. Yep 6 weeks - I'm excited, funny how my weakness is no longer my weakness and my strength has become my weakness.
Swimming is coming along great. This past week I had some great swim sessions and I swam 2000 yds on Saturday which is over the distance I need to do for the tri. Rob watched me on Saturday and was amazed at my progress. He says I have good form but I need to figure out the bi-lateral breathing. He thinks that will definitely be needed when swimming in a crowd or not so smooth water and he thinks that might improve my speed.
Biking - oh no, those hills are probably going to kill me. I so have not been outside on my bike. I have been attending spin classes pretty regularly and I often spend extra time before or after class but I know from a mileage perspective and a hills perspective I'm not there. So I need to get out on my bike. The good news is there is lot of hills in our new community. The bad news is that I'm not comfortable riding on the main road near us because the speed limit is 60 mph and I see how people drive on that road. We do see lots of cyclists but just not sure if I'm ready for that.
Running is running. I haven't been getting the time or the mileage in so that has to be a focus point for me.
Weight loss - it's been up and down the past couple of weeks but I'm ok with that wanted to hold steady for a bit and focus on other things.
Strength training - that big goose egg has got to change. Now that I've met my first weight loss goal I'm realizing I really need to tone up the muscles. Also the distance swimming is really giving me a sore back, nothing long term just when I start to get up there in distance so I know I need to build up the strength in my back and abs.
Overall still doing well, the sessions above don't reflect that but I mentally I feel that I'm in a solid place for 6 weeks away from my first International distance tri.
